Tessera is seeking a professional and motivated Roads & Grounds Supervisor to perform a variety of administrative, supervisory and semi-skilled to skilled tasks, requiring an understanding of established plans and procedures for the supervision of grounds maintenance operations at Fort Lee.

Core Leadership Responsibilities:
  • Develop a strong understanding of AbilityOne and SourceAmerica programs.
  • Uphold and embody Tessera's core values.
  • Align team goals with Tessera's value proposition, ensuring highly engaged employee contribute to customer satisfaction.
  • Identify and mitigate safety hazards on job sites through effective risk controls and utilize activity Hazard Analysis (AHA).
  • Conduct root cause analyses to promote a safe working environment and maintain adherence to Tessera's Accident Reporting process.
  • Foster positive client interactions using effective interpersonal skills, demonstrating respect, empathy, and responsiveness.


Essential Duties Include but Are Not Limited To:
  • Supervises equipment operators, truck drivers, tractor operators, mechanics, grounds maintenance laborers, and temporary employees as required.
  • Plans and organizes workloads and staff assignments; trains, motivates, evaluates and counsels assigned staff; reviews progress and directs changes as needed.
  • Provides advice to staff; communicates official plans, policies and procedures.
  • Assures that assigned areas of responsibility are performed within budget; assures effective and efficient use of personnel, materials, facilities and time.
  • Oversee post-wide grounds maintenance to include, but not limited to mowing, trimming, edging, seeding, fertilizing, mulching, weed control, and various other tasks involving heaving equipment and tractor operations.
  • Oversee the construction/repair/maintenance of roads, including clearing, grading, drainage and foundation work.
  • Oversee post-wide snow removal operations as required.
  • Responsible for preparation of various documents to include schedules, progress reports, training plans, attendance status, performance evaluations, time keeping records, accident reports, and other employee documents as necessary.
  • Communicates and interacts directly with the customer; informing the customer of grounds maintenance activities and determining customer needs.
  • Responds to customer inquiries and complaints.
  • Ensure quality service to meet contract requirements.
  • Ensures follow-up is conducted on discrepancies identified by QC and QA inspections, and ensures corrections are made as necessary.
  • Conducts supply and equipment inventory and ensures accountability.
  • Ensures tools and equipment are maintained in accordance with preventive maintenance schedule.
  • Ensures all areas are clean, sanitary, safe and orderly, and remain in a functional state.
  • Maintain a professional appearance and always adhere to PPE and safety requirements.
  • All other duties as assigned.
